Mixed Fermentation barrel fermented Farmhouse Ale brewed with Honey and aged in red wine barrels conditioned on whole hibiscus flowers, grapefruit peel and a touch of pink Himalayan sea salt.

Flat, opaque, ruby brown pour. Residual goop sticks to the bottle.
Aroma is rich sour plum, black cherry & hibiscus black tea. The grapefruit pith is plenty fumes & irritating in my nose but is no longer grapefruit.
Bruin malt feels with extra black cherry juice & skin. Very tart yet sweet, it's all dark cherry skin & grapefruit pith bite. There is some slight medicinal 'tussin that I'm ignoring.
Boozy warmth, lingering acidity, coating, didn't need carb.
Great.
